body, table {
font-size:10pt;
font-family:Arial, Helvetica, sans-serif;
color:#FFFFFF;
font-style:normal;
font-weight: bold;
}

a {
	color: #FFFFFF;
	text-decoration: none;
	font: bold;
}

a:visited {
	color: #FFFFFF;
	text-decoration: none;
	font: bold;
}

a:hover {
	color: #CCCCCC;
	font: bold;
}
/* középre rakás*/

body { text-align: center; }

div#container
{
margin-left: auto;
margin-right: auto;
width: 50em;
text-align: left;
}

/* CSS Document */
html, body {
height: 100%;
background: url(images/fullalap.jpg)  center;
margin: 0 auto;
padding: 0;
}

#alap {
height: 100%;
width: 785px;
margin: 0 auto;
padding: 0;
text-align: left;

}

#fejlec { 
height: 89px;
margin: 0 auto;
padding: 0;
text-align: center;
background: url(images/fejlec.jpg) no-repeat top left;
}


#menusor {
height: 22px;
margin: 0 auto;
padding: 0;
text-align: center;
vertical-align:bottom;
background: url(images/menusoralap.jpg) no-repeat top left;
}


#balmenu {
width: 153px;
margin: 0 auto;
padding: 0;
float: left;
/*background: url(images/balmenualap.jpg) repeat-y;*/
height: 100%;
}

#main {
	width: auto;
	margin: 0 auto;
	padding:0;
	float: right;
	/*background: url(images/mainalap.jpg)  repeat-y;*/
	height: 100%;
	color:#666666;
	font:normal;
	z-index: 9;
}

.maindiv {
width:607px;
padding-top:10px;
padding-bottom:10px;
padding-left:10px;
padding-right:15px;
}

.kistraktorsor {
	width: 785px;
	height:106px;
	background: url(images/kistraktorsor.jpg) no-repeat bottom left;
	position:absolute;
	z-index:5;
	top: 394px;

}

.menutabl {
margin: 0;
padding: 0;
}

#navigation li {
display: inline;
list-style-type: none;
}

/*balbutton____________________________*/
.balbutton a {
	background: url(images/balbutton.jpg) no-repeat;
	height: 25px;
	display: block;
	margin: 0;
	padding-top: 5px;
	text-decoration: none;
	text-indent: 20pt;
	overflow: hidden;
	color: #FFFFFF;
	text-decoration: none;
	font: bold;
	font-size:10pt;
	text-align: left;
	
}

 
.balbutton a:hover{
  background-position: 0 -30px;
}
/*balbutton__vége__________________________*/

/*produktymenu____________________________*/
.produktymenualap a{
color: #000000;
}
.produktymenualap a:hover{
color: #000000;
filter:alpha(opacity=90);
	-moz-opacity:0.9;
	opacity: 0.9; 
}
.produktymenualap {
font-size:9pt;
color: #000000;
/*background-color:#CCCCCC;*/
filter:alpha(opacity=80);
	-moz-opacity:0.8;
	opacity: 0.8; 
	}
/*produktymenu______vége______________________*/

/*produkty táblázat_______________________________*/
.prodtablfejlec {

font-size:9pt;
color:#FFF5F4;
background-color:#AC8D8A;
text-align:center;
}
.prodtablsor1 {
font-size:9pt;
background-color:#FEFCFC;
color:#390D04;
text-align:center;
font-weight: normal;
}
.prodtablsor2 {
font-size:9pt;
color:#390D04;
background-color:#F3E6E4;
text-align:center;
font-weight: normal;
}
.prodtablsorures {
font-size:9pt;
color:#390D04;
text-align:center;
font-weight: normal;
}


/*produkty táblázat____vége___________________________*/
img {border:0}

.megjegyzes {
font-size:8pt;
color:#333333;
font-weight:normal;
}

